Gary D. Dye, 65

Gary D. Dye, 65, went home to be with the Lord on May 12, 2026, after a courageous 14-month battle with pancreatic cancer. He passed away peacefully at home surrounded by his loving wife and daughters by his side.

Gary was a devoted husband, father, grandfather, brother, son, and friend. He is survived by his wife, Dana Dye; his mother, Lois Dye; his daughters, Jessica Kelly and Sara Yacono; Jessica’s partner, David Henning, and children, Bailey and Hoyt; and Sara’s husband, Nicholas Yacono, and daughter, Sylvie. He is also survived by his younger brother, Brian Dye.

Gary was preceded in death by his father, Claude Dye, and his older brother, Ronald Dye.

Gary had a passion for the outdoors and enjoyed bicycling, hunting, fishing, and riding his motorcycle. He was known for his amazing sense of humor and his ability to make people laugh. He loved his church and church family. More than anything, Gary loved his family deeply, especially his grandchildren, who brought him endless pride and joy.

He will be remembered for his warmth, laughter, strength, and the love he shared so freely with those around him. His memory will live on in the hearts of all who knew and loved him.

A visitation will be held on May 21, 2026, from 9:00 a.m. to 10:45 a.m., followed by a funeral service at 11:00 a.m. at Mountain View Chapel 68 Old Douglass Dr, Douglassville, PA 19518. Burial will be private.

In lieu of flowers, memorial donations may be made in Gary’s honor to RAGBRAI gives. https://ragbrai.com/gives/
